Theoretical and Experimental Heat and Mass Transfer Analysis for a Falling Film Outside a Grooved Tube
Authors:C Onan  DB Ozkan
Institution:1. Department of Mechanical Engineering, Yildiz Technical University, Istanbul, Turkeyconan@yildiz.edu.tr;3. Department of Mechanical Engineering, Yildiz Technical University, Istanbul, Turkey
Abstract:The heat and mass transfer from a grooved tube is investigated experimentally for a falling-film flow. The experiments are conducted on a helical trapezoidal grooved tube at three temperatures of the feeding water: 30°C, 35°C, and 40°C. The Reynolds number (Re) of the air ranges between 1,500 and 3,500. Nusselt number (Nu) is expressed as a function of the Prandtl number (Pr), Re for air (Rea), Re for water (Rew); Sherwood number (Sh) is expressed as a function of the Schmidt number (Sc), Rea, and Rew, and the correlation coefficients are determined.
